Tyler, TX County has a lower than average rate of violent crime when compared to the national average. Specifically, the violent crime rate in Tyler is 13.3, which is less than half of the national average of 22.7. Property crime is also less than the US average with a rate of 22.8 compared to 35.4 nationally. This means that Tyler citizens can feel more secure knowing their municipality has lower rates of both violent and property crime than the national averages.
Crime is ranked on a scale of 1 (low crime) to 100 (high crime)
Tyler County violent crime is 13.3. (The US average is 22.7)
Tyler County property crime is 22.8. (The US average is 35.4)
